1. Product Overview

The BlueStars 35-6780 21001906 Washer Drain Pump with Pulley is a replacement component designed to expel water from your washing machine. This pump is activated after the spin cycle maintains a specific speed and is driven by the same drive belt that operates the transmission pulley. Proper functioning of this pump is crucial for effective water drainage from your washer.

5. Installation Instructions

Installation of the drain pump requires basic tools and careful attention. The following tools are typically needed:

  • 5/16 nut driver
  • Putty knife
  • 3/8 socket with a ratchet
  • Pair of slip joint pliers

General Steps:

  1. Disconnect Power: Ensure the washing machine is unplugged from the electrical outlet and the water supply is turned off.
  2. Access the Pump: Depending on your washer model, you may need to tilt the washer back or remove a front/rear panel to access the drain pump.
  3. Drain Residual Water: Place a shallow pan under the pump and hoses to catch any remaining water. Disconnect the hoses from the pump.
  4. Remove Old Pump: Unfasten any mounting screws or clips holding the old pump in place. Disconnect electrical connectors.
  5. Install New Pump: Attach the new BlueStars drain pump, ensuring all connections (hoses and electrical) are secure.
  6. Reassemble: Reattach any panels or components removed during access.
  7. Test: Restore power and water supply. Run a short cycle to check for leaks and proper drainage.

8. Troubleshooting

The 35-6780 21001906 Washer Drain Pump is designed to fix common washer symptoms. If your washer exhibits any of the following issues, the drain pump may be the cause:

  • Noisy: Unusual sounds during the drain cycle.
  • Leaking: Water leaking from the bottom of the washer.
  • Will not drain: Water remains in the tub after the wash cycle.
  • Burning smell: An electrical burning smell during operation.

If your washer is experiencing these symptoms, inspect the drain pump for clogs or damage. The pump could be clogged by a small object or could be broken and in need of replacing.
